Step-by-Step Guide: How to Dispute a Subscription Charge
Follow this 12-step process for general/unauthorized charges (works for 90% cases):
- Review statement: Note charge date, amount, merchant name.
- Check account: Log in to merchant site--cancel immediately.
- Contact merchant: Use email/phone; request refund with "FTC violation" mention. Template: "I dispute [charge] as unauthorized per FTC rules."
- Document everything: Screenshots, timestamps.
- Wait 5-10 days for response.
- File dispute: App/portal with bank (online) or PayPal (Resolution Center).
- Provisional credit: Issued in 1-2 billing cycles (FCBA rule).
- Submit evidence: See checklist below.
- Respond to inquiries: 10-45 days typical.
- Appeal denial: Within 10 days.
- Escalate: CFPB complaint or small claims.
- Monitor: Full resolution in 30-90 days.
2026 Timeline: Max 120 days for errors; fraud unlimited if reported promptly. Success stat: 75% with strong proof.
Checklist: Proving an Unauthorized Subscription Charge
- [ ] Bank statement screenshot.
- [ ] Merchant login--no recognition?
- [ ] IP/email logs (request from bank).
- [ ] No prior consent emails.
- [ ] Card used elsewhere? Affidavit of non-use.
- [ ] Police report for fraud >$100.
Pro tip: Use tools like Have I Been Pwned for breach proof.

Subscription Charge Dispute Letter Template & Bank Guidelines
Free Template (Copy-paste to bank/merchant):
[Your Name/Address]
[Date]
[Bank/Merchant Name]
Re: Dispute of Charge [Amount/Date] - Unauthorized Subscription
Dear Sir/Madam,
I dispute the charge of $[AMT] on [DATE] from [MERCHANT] as unauthorized per FCBA/FTC rules. I did not authorize this recurring subscription. Evidence attached: [list].
Please issue full refund and cancel future charges.
Sincerely,
[Your Name/Account #]
Bank guidelines: Provisional credit in 2 cycles; full investigation 90 days max.
